Chili Cheese Toast Recipe

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Category: Appetizer
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American, Fusion
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Chili Cheese Toast is a delicious and spicy cheesy toast that makes for a perfect snack or appetizer. With a blend of cheddar and mozzarella cheeses, green chilies, and a hint of garlic, this toast is flavorful and satisfying.


Ingredients

Scale

Bread:

  • 4 slices of thick-cut bread (such as sourdough or white sandwich bread)

Cheese Mixture:

  • 1 tablespoon unsalted butter (softened)
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1 small green chili (finely chopped, or use 1/4 teaspoon chili flakes)
  • 1 tablespoon chopped green onions
  • 1 clove garlic (minced)
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• Pinch of salt
  • Optional: red chili powder or paprika for topping


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Prepare the Cheese Mixture: In a bowl, mix the cheddar cheese, mozzarella cheese, green chili, green onions, garlic, black pepper, and salt.
  3. Assemble the Toasts: Lightly butter each slice of bread and place them on a baking sheet, buttered side down. Evenly distribute the cheese mixture over the top of each slice. Sprinkle with red chili powder or paprika if desired.
  4. Bake: Bake for 8–10 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the edges of the bread are golden brown.
  5. Serve: Serve hot as a delicious snack or appetizer.

Notes

  • You can use pre-shredded cheese for convenience, but freshly shredded cheese melts better.
  • Adjust the heat by using milder or spicier chilies.
  • Add cooked crumbled sausage or bacon for a meaty twist.
